SEOUL, April 17 (Reuters) – North Korea fired two projectiles off its eastern coast on Saturday, the South Korean military said on Sunday.

The South Korean army general staff said the projectiles, launched from the Hamhung region in northeastern North Korea at around 6 p.m. local time the previous day, had traveled 110 km.

North Korea’s KCNA news agency reported on Sunday that North Korea’s leader Kim Jong-un witnessed the test firing of a new tactical weapon aimed at boosting the country’s nuclear capabilities, without indicating when the test will take place. was unrolled.
